2022-01-202022-01-201973-02https://dc.statelibrary.sc.gov/handle/10827/42135The South Carolina Wildlife Magazine, published by the Department of Natural Resources, is dedicated to the conservation, protection and restoration of our state’s wildlife and natural resources, and to the education of our people to the value of these resources. It includes conservation success stories, heartwarming reflections, humorous tales, intriguing field notes, delectable recipes and awe-inspiring outdoor adventures. In this issue: The Remarkable Mr. Ed ; The Night Hunter ; South Carolina's Alligators - Blessing or Blight? ; Shark! ; Our Land: Changes and Challenges ; Cottonfield Cottontails ; Ocean Gems ; Books ; Readers Forum ; Wildlife Roundtable.application/pdfDocumentCopyright © South Carolina Wildlife.
